BOSNIAN GOVERNMENT MINISTERS TO GET PAY RAISE OF 108 PER CENT THIS MONTH

SARAJEVO, Bosnia (July 4,2008) - The new law regulating salaries in the Bosnian government institutions has come into force, and higher salaries are expected from this month.

The new salary formula is especially favourable for members of the Bosnian State Presidency, government ministers, cabinet heads and assistants.

The salary of ministers has thus been increased by 108 per cent, while their assistants are to get 73.61 per cent more every month.

BOSNIAN STATE PARLIAMENT ADOPTED DRAFT LAW ON BOSNIAN SPORT

SARAJEVO, Bosnia (February 26,2008) – The Bosnian State Parliament's House of Peoples adopted the draft law on the Bosnian Sport in the same text in which was earlier adopted by the House of Representatives.

With this law, among other things, a Council for the Bosnian Sport is formed as a highest counseling body of the Bosnian Ministry of Civil Affairs which deals with the development and quality of sport in Bosnia.

Also, an agency for doping control is formed which is necessary if our athletes wish to compete at international venues.

Delegates also adopted the draft law on changing and amending the law on the Bosnian travel documents. Considering that the House of Representatives earlier adopted this draft law in somewhat different text some adjustments shall be needed between the houses.
